Exclamation Can't see my harddrive

I have recently installed a second harddrive. Bios detects it no problem, device manager detects it no problem, but it is invisible in "my computer". I have had slave harddrives before so its nothing to do with not having enough room for IDE controllers. Theres no stupid rule that the master has to have more capacity than the slave because my master is 120gb but my slave is 250gb. Any help would be greatly appreciated

You need to format the drive, if you have xp, look at disk management. If it is there then it needs formatting.
